基于反电动势法的步进电机堵转检测应用研究  被引量:1

Application Research on the Stall Detection of Stepping Motors Based upon the Back EMF Method

摘  要:步进电机具有结构简单、控制方便等优点,被广泛应用在负载不大、速度要求不高的开环控制系统中。文章基于TRINAMIC公司PD-1140驱动模块开发的测试盒,并结合反电动势堵转检测算法StallGuard2,进行堵转测试实验,确定测试参数和测试方法,为开环控制步进电机提供了实用的无传感器堵转测试诊断方法。Because of the stepping motor’s advantages of single structure and being easy to be controlled,it is widely used into the open-loop control system in which both the motor load and moving speed are not very high.The stall detection test is conducted by employing the test box consisted of the PD-1140 module developed by TRINAMIC Company and combined with the StallGuard2 calculation method for the stall detection of stepping motors,so as to determine the test parameters and test way,providing the open-loop controlled stepping motor a practical diagnose method by means of the stall detection without sensor.

关 键 词:步进电机 反电动势 堵转检测
